Output 95d38e71586c18bfb07ae740ad4040da80c6c2439a95ee351bf98ffb434b75c6:1

value
255918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cc2f3fbf2f3c0a860b9f3a9f8958869b1c923cf OP_EQUALVERIFY OP_CHECKSIG
address
17zsuA1okiKotKc5S7yUSe9gFeWnFRYW2T
transaction
95d38e71586c18bfb07ae740ad4040da80c6c2439a95ee351bf98ffb434b75c6
spent
true